What are the responsibilities and job description for the Boat Captain (Master) position at Cardinal Point Captains, Inc?

Description

POSITION: Full Time, Non-Exempt

LOCATION: Naval Base Point Loma, CA

PAY RANGE: $45.62 per hour plus $7.50 (Health & Wellness through the Union)

RELOCATION: No relocation offered for this position

We are currently seeking to hire a Vessel Captain aboard the Range Support Craft 4 (RSC-4) to be responsible for the day-to-day operation and maintenance of assigned vessels. This position requires a strong understanding of maritime operations, navigation, safety standards, and the ability to lead and communicate effectively with both government stakeholders and internal teams.

The RSC-4 is a 114-foot aluminum vessel providing fleet training support to the Southern California Tactical Training Range (SCTTR) in the San Clemente Island Range Complex (SCIRC) W-291 area.

Primary Duties And Responsibilities

  • Reports to Port Captain.
  • Responsible for the day-to-day operation and maintenance of an assigned vessel.
  • Ensures that the vessel crew has adequate supplies and training to safely execute tasking.
  • Plans voyage and operates vessel in a safe manner in accordance with USCG requirements.
  • Ensures that all vessel operations are compliant with Federal, State, and local regulations.
  • Accurately completes required daily logs.

Work Conditions

  • Will work ashore and afloat on the RSC vessels.
  • Overtime is required.
  • Vessels may stay out at sea and not return to port multiple days in a row (occurs frequently).
  • Operations are conducted in a variety of weather conditions and sea states.
  • Normal shipboard physical activity is required.

Requirements

Education/Experience:

  • High School diploma or equivalent is required.
  • A minimum of five (5) years of prior maritime industry experience working as a Captain of a 500GT vessel (to include managing personnel and operational schedules); ten (10) years of such experience is preferred.
  • Must have demonstrable knowledge of preventive/corrective maintenance plans.
  • Previous experience on DoD contract vessels.
  • USCG License 500GT Master Upon Near Coastal Waters with valid medical certificate is required.
  • Current Driver’s License required; must be able to be insured through company’s vehicle insurance policy while driving work/government/rental vehicles during working hours, and for the duration of employment.
  • All candidates will be required to pass background screening to include SSN, Driver Record, and Criminal Background Investigation.

Skills

  • Proven leadership in managing crew, operational timelines, and mission success.
  • Proficiency in electronic navigation systems (ECDIS, radar, GPS), maintenance logs, and Microsoft Office applications.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work in physically demanding environments.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ills for clear reporting and mission coordination.

Additional Requirements

  • U.S. Citizenship required.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ain a SECRET DoD Security Clearance.
  • Valid state driver’s license; must qualify under company’s vehicle insurance policy.
  • Must pass a pre-employment drug screening.
  • Willingness to travel as needed to support operations, including potential CONUS/OCONUS locations.
